Varying Rules in the Congregation
by cantleave inthe society rarely phrases its man made rule as thou shall or shalt not, but makes "suggestions".
the elders of each congregation will then enforce those "suggestions" to a greater or lesser extent, depending on the demographics of each elder body.
the inconsistancies result in uncertainty and that in itself becomes an additional form of control.. it is possible for someone who has only experienced only one or two congregations to read someone elses experience on a site like this one and may think, that does not happen in the organisation.

It is unacceptable if you are available by cell then perhaps issue an email saying that you will not be in a position to use your lap tops outside office hours and if you are required then please can they call you on your cell phone. Copy your manager in and see if he makes an issue of it.
If he does keep a copy of all out of office hours emails and your responses and show them to him at your next review indicationg how intrusive they are and how much time it takes.
I was in a similar position except I was expected to go into my place of work to sort out issues some of which occured early in the morning (24hr site) When I decided to leave I got copies of the clocking in records and showed personnel that I had worked an extra week's worth of hours in a 2 month period for which I wasn't paid, not including travelling time. It also showed that I hadn't had a full weekend off in 3 months. If you have family it is not on. Keep a record of how much time you spend checking mail what isn't measured can't be quantified.
